Управляемое реле температуры. Не включается со старта.

Надо подправить программу.

Roman9
Рядовой
Сообщения: 25
Зарегистрирован: 03.02.2019{, 11:47}
Репутация: 0
Имя: Роман

Управляемое реле температуры. Не включается со старта.

#1

Сообщение Roman9 » 03.02.2019{, 12:42}

Всем добрый день. Пока админы не пускают на форум, задам вопрос здесь.
Тренируюсь по уроку и споткнулся :smile390:
Делаю управляемое реле. Сначала сделал без кнопок как в уроке. Вариант №1. Всё работает отлично.
Далее я усложнил задачу Вар. №2 и добавив КН1, КН2 и КН3, КН4. К каждой кнопке я добавил генератор для того чтобы при удержании кнопки цифры "бежали" со скоростью 200мс. На дисплей выводится: показания температуры с датчика, нижний предел, верхний предел и диапазон в градусах в который будет поддерживать реле. Вместо реле -LED. Но вот какая незадача. При фиксированных значениях пределов Вар. №1 LED включается с самого начала работы и работает до того уровня пока не достигнет верхнего предела. А если я использую вариант №2, то LED включается только когда температура датчика попадает в установленный диапазон, а должно реле нагреть с начала работы. Думаю что-то не то с цифрой приходящий от кнопок выставления значений. Я начинающий. Хотелось бы понять. Подскажите пожалуйста. :smile250:

Отправлено спустя 1 минуту 17 секунд:
Забыл файл программы прикрепить.
Вложения
21 Температура 4 кнопки.flp
(201.84 КБ) 45 скачиваний
0DfeSK-wHdk.jpg
UGvtrC4uPaQ.jpg
Реле температуры 4 кнопки.jpg
Реле температуры без кнопок.jpg

krom23
Лейтенант
Сообщения: 444
Зарегистрирован: 06.09.2015{, 15:18}
Репутация: 12
Откуда: Калуга
Имя: Андрей

Управляемое реле температуры. Не включается со старта.

#2

Сообщение krom23 » 03.02.2019{, 13:36}

Для начала упростите схему убрав блок сложения, подключив выходы счётчиков напрямую к компараторам. Математикой пользуйтесь только при необходимости, не любят атмелки математику, особенно опнерации с "0" которые накаутируют контроллер. В остальном вторая схема должна работать как первая, если не попутать верхний предел с нижним. А если перепутаны, то инвертируйте выход на реле.

Roman9
Рядовой
Сообщения: 25
Зарегистрирован: 03.02.2019{, 11:47}
Репутация: 0
Имя: Роман

Управляемое реле температуры. Не включается со старта.

#3

Сообщение Roman9 » 03.02.2019{, 14:09}

krom23 писал(а):
03.02.2019{, 13:36}
Для начала упростите схему убрав блок сложения, подключив выходы счётчиков напрямую к компараторам. Математикой пользуйтесь только при необходимости, не любят атмелки математику, особенно опнерации с "0" которые накаутируют контроллер. В остальном вторая схема должна работать как первая, если не попутать верхний предел с нижним. А если перепутаны, то инвертируйте выход на реле.
Попробовал. Всё-равно по какой-то причине не включается LED. Убрал сложение, LEd не включается даже если довести значение до равного датчику.

Аватара пользователя
Phazz
Полковник
Сообщения: 2560
Зарегистрирован: 17.10.2016{, 15:38}
Репутация: 367
Откуда: Сургут
Имя: Анатолий

Управляемое реле температуры. Не включается со старта.

#4

Сообщение Phazz » 03.02.2019{, 14:10}

В первом варианте уберите rtrig и во втором в том же месте

Roman9
Рядовой
Сообщения: 25
Зарегистрирован: 03.02.2019{, 11:47}
Репутация: 0
Имя: Роман

Управляемое реле температуры. Не включается со старта.

#5

Сообщение Roman9 » 03.02.2019{, 14:18}

Что-то такая простая схема, а работать не хочет.

Аватара пользователя
Phazz
Полковник
Сообщения: 2560
Зарегистрирован: 17.10.2016{, 15:38}
Репутация: 367
Откуда: Сургут
Имя: Анатолий

Управляемое реле температуры. Не включается со старта.

#6

Сообщение Phazz » 03.02.2019{, 14:22}

Roman9, триггер не пробовали убирать?

Roman9
Рядовой
Сообщения: 25
Зарегистрирован: 03.02.2019{, 11:47}
Репутация: 0
Имя: Роман

Управляемое реле температуры. Не включается со старта.

#7

Сообщение Roman9 » 03.02.2019{, 14:37}

Phazz писал(а):
03.02.2019{, 14:22}
Roman9, триггер не пробовали убирать?
Убрал, тоже самое. Вот я думаю, может это просто глюк какой.

Аватара пользователя
Phazz
Полковник
Сообщения: 2560
Зарегистрирован: 17.10.2016{, 15:38}
Репутация: 367
Откуда: Сургут
Имя: Анатолий

Управляемое реле температуры. Не включается со старта.

#8

Сообщение Phazz » 03.02.2019{, 15:03}

Roman9, А после перезапуска у вас же 0 на счётчиках. После перезапуска ничего не будет работать пока не будут выставлены значения.

Roman9
Рядовой
Сообщения: 25
Зарегистрирован: 03.02.2019{, 11:47}
Репутация: 0
Имя: Роман

Управляемое реле температуры. Не включается со старта.

#9

Сообщение Roman9 » 03.02.2019{, 15:48}

Phazz писал(а):
03.02.2019{, 15:03}
Roman9, А после перезапуска у вас же 0 на счётчиках. После перезапуска ничего не будет работать пока не будут выставлены значения.
КН2 подключил для проверки LED.
Перезапуск. LED не горит. Нагреваю датчик более 30 также не горит. Охлаждаю ниже 26 тоже не горит.
Вложения
Термо-проверка.jpg

Roman9
Рядовой
Сообщения: 25
Зарегистрирован: 03.02.2019{, 11:47}
Репутация: 0
Имя: Роман

Управляемое реле температуры. Не включается со старта.

#10

Сообщение Roman9 » 03.02.2019{, 15:53}

А вот так вот всё заработало. Почему триггер RS не работал как надо я не пойму.
Вложения
Термо-проверка2.jpg

Аватара пользователя
Phazz
Полковник
Сообщения: 2560
Зарегистрирован: 17.10.2016{, 15:38}
Репутация: 367
Откуда: Сургут
Имя: Анатолий

Управляемое реле температуры. Не включается со старта.

#11

Сообщение Phazz » 03.02.2019{, 16:11}

Ничего не понял, у вас уже и первый вариант не работает?

Roman9
Рядовой
Сообщения: 25
Зарегистрирован: 03.02.2019{, 11:47}
Репутация: 0
Имя: Роман

Управляемое реле температуры. Не включается со старта.

#12

Сообщение Roman9 » 03.02.2019{, 16:13}

Phazz писал(а):
03.02.2019{, 16:11}
Ничего не понял, у вас уже и первый вариант не работает?
Да. У меня почему-то первый вариант как в видеоуроке через RS триггер почему-то не работалю

Аватара пользователя
Phazz
Полковник
Сообщения: 2560
Зарегистрирован: 17.10.2016{, 15:38}
Репутация: 367
Откуда: Сургут
Имя: Анатолий

Управляемое реле температуры. Не включается со старта.

#13

Сообщение Phazz » 03.02.2019{, 16:44}

Roman9,Накидал проектик, все работает. Попробуйте поставить блок преобразования из float в integer
СпойлерПоказать
2019-02-03_18-43-26.png
2019-02-03_18-43-26.png (6.28 КБ) 582 просмотра

Аватара пользователя
Phazz
Полковник
Сообщения: 2560
Зарегистрирован: 17.10.2016{, 15:38}
Репутация: 367
Откуда: Сургут
Имя: Анатолий

Управляемое реле температуры. Не включается со старта.

#14

Сообщение Phazz » 03.02.2019{, 16:52}

RS триггер можно сделать ещё так ;)
СпойлерПоказать
2019-02-03_18-49-58.png
2019-02-03_18-49-58.png (3.42 КБ) 579 просмотров

Roman9
Рядовой
Сообщения: 25
Зарегистрирован: 03.02.2019{, 11:47}
Репутация: 0
Имя: Роман

Управляемое реле температуры. Не включается со старта.

#15

Сообщение Roman9 » 03.02.2019{, 16:55}

Phazz писал(а):
03.02.2019{, 16:52}
RS триггер можно сделать ещё так ;)
СпойлерПоказать
2019-02-03_18-49-58.png
Благодарствую!!!!!!!!!! Очень всё это интересно. Буквально через мин 20 попробую все варианты. :yes:

Аватара пользователя
rw6cm
Полковник
Сообщения: 2284
Зарегистрирован: 06.09.2015{, 20:25}
Репутация: 335
Имя: Владимир

Управляемое реле температуры. Не включается со старта.

#16

Сообщение rw6cm » 03.02.2019{, 19:10}

Roman9,
Для поста1 достаточно пост4, для поста9 поставить OR
СпойлерПоказать
2019_02_03_19_02_00_FLProg_4.2.4.png
2019_02_03_19_02_00_FLProg_4.2.4.png (6.24 КБ) 556 просмотров
Win10-64, FLProg (portable)

Roman9
Рядовой
Сообщения: 25
Зарегистрирован: 03.02.2019{, 11:47}
Репутация: 0
Имя: Роман

Управляемое реле температуры. Не включается со старта.

#17

Сообщение Roman9 » 03.02.2019{, 19:34}

Phazz писал(а):
03.02.2019{, 16:44}
Roman9,Накидал проектик, все работает. Попробуйте поставить блок преобразования из float в integer
СпойлерПоказать
2019-02-03_18-43-26.png
Попробовал с блоком преобразования из float в integer и без. Результат такой. Да, он стартует и при достижении верхнего предела LED отключается.
Но когда температура падает ниже установленного предела, то не включается. А сделав эту схему с датчиком температуры, да, спасибо большое :smile44: , тоже работает. Сейчас попробую вписать туда кнопки управления.

Roman9
Рядовой
Сообщения: 25
Зарегистрирован: 03.02.2019{, 11:47}
Репутация: 0
Имя: Роман

Управляемое реле температуры. Не включается со старта.

#18

Сообщение Roman9 » 03.02.2019{, 19:45}

Phazz писал(а):
03.02.2019{, 16:44}
Roman9,Накидал проектик, все работает. Попробуйте поставить блок преобразования из float в integer
СпойлерПоказать
2019-02-03_18-43-26.png
Попробовал совместить эту схему с с добавлением кнопок и конверторов.
Снова не стартует LED.
Вложения
Не стартует LED.jpg

Roman9
Рядовой
Сообщения: 25
Зарегистрирован: 03.02.2019{, 11:47}
Репутация: 0
Имя: Роман

Управляемое реле температуры. Не включается со старта.

#19

Сообщение Roman9 » 03.02.2019{, 20:01}

Вот. Поменял наоборот оба компаратора. Теперь стартует, доходит до критической температуры, но потом при понижении температуры, снова не стартует.
СпойлерПоказать
Стартует но повторно не включается при падении температуры.jpg

Roman9
Рядовой
Сообщения: 25
Зарегистрирован: 03.02.2019{, 11:47}
Репутация: 0
Имя: Роман

Управляемое реле температуры. Не включается со старта.

#20

Сообщение Roman9 » 03.02.2019{, 20:16}

rw6cm писал(а):
03.02.2019{, 19:10}
Roman9,
Для поста1 достаточно пост4, для поста9 поставить OR
СпойлерПоказать
2019_02_03_19_02_00_FLProg_4.2.4.png
Благодарю. Без OR работает как надо. А с ним, почему-то при достижении верхней границы и выше LED продолжает гореть.

Ответить

Вернуться в «Помогите, а то я "нимагу"»